Advertisement
Guest User

Untitled

a guest
Oct 22nd, 2019
78
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 6.40 KB | None | 0 0
  1. <?php
  2. /**
  3. * @package WordPress
  4. * @subpackage Kleo
  5. * @author SeventhQueen <themesupport@seventhqueen.com>
  6. * @since Kleo 1.0
  7. */
  8.  
  9. /**
  10. * Kleo Child Theme Functions
  11. * Add custom code below
  12. */
  13.  
  14.  
  15. function sqr_dev_load_conditional_jquery() {
  16.  
  17. if( bp_is_directory() ) {
  18.  
  19. ?>
  20. <script>
  21. jQuery( document ).ready(function($) {
  22.  
  23.  
  24. // $.fn.quickChange = function(handler) {
  25. // return this.each(function() {
  26. // var self = this;
  27. // self.qcindex = self.selectedIndex;
  28. // var interval;
  29. // function handleChange() {
  30. // if (self.selectedIndex != self.qcindex) {
  31. // self.qcindex = self.selectedIndex;
  32. // handler.apply(self);
  33. // }
  34. // }
  35. // $(self).focus(function() {
  36. // interval = setInterval(handleChange, 100);
  37. // }).blur(function() { window.clearInterval(interval); })
  38. // .change(handleChange); //also wire the change event in case the interval technique isn't supported (chrome on android)
  39. // });
  40. // };
  41.  
  42. $("div[class*=field_96]").hide();
  43. $("div[class*=field_131]").hide(); //shoe male and female
  44. $("div[class*=field_91]").hide();
  45. $("div[class*=field_97]").hide();
  46. $("div[class*=field_98]").hide();
  47. $("div[class*=field_1216]").hide();
  48. $("div[class*=field_99]").hide();
  49. $("div[class*=field_100]").hide();
  50. $("div[class*=field_112]").hide();
  51. $("div[class*=field_140]").hide();
  52. $("div[class*=field_147]").hide();
  53. $("div[class*=field_208]").hide();
  54. $("div[class*=field_209]").hide();
  55. $("div[class*=field_216]").hide();
  56. $("div[class*=field_219]").hide();
  57. $("div[class*=field_222]").hide();
  58. $("div[class*=field_370]").hide();
  59. $("div[class*=field_371]").hide();
  60. $("div[class*=field_372]").hide();
  61. $("div[class*=field_374]").hide();
  62. $("div[class*=field_375]").hide();
  63. $("div[class*=field_393]").hide();
  64. $("div[class*=field_419]").hide();
  65. $("div[class*=field_453]").hide();
  66. $("div[class*=field_456]").hide();
  67. $("div[class*=field_452]").hide();
  68. $("div[class*=field_797").hide(); //agencies
  69. $("div[class*=field_229").hide(); //generes
  70.  
  71. $("ul.multiselect-container > li input").change( function() {
  72. var selected = $(this).closest(".btn-group").find("button.multiselect").prop("title").split(', ');
  73. if( selected.indexOf('Female Model') != -1 ) {
  74. $("div[class*=field_96]").show(); //height male and female
  75. $("div[class*=field_91]").show(); //weight male and female
  76. $("div[class*=field_97]").show(); //bust female only
  77. $("div[class*=field_98]").show(); //weist female and male model
  78. $("div[class*=field_1216]").show(); //date of birth
  79. $("div[class*=field_99]").show(); //hips only men
  80. $("div[class*=field_100]").show(); //cup only woman
  81. $("div[class*=field_112]").show(); //dress only woman
  82. $("div[class*=field_131]").show(); //shoe show only woman
  83. $("div[class*=field_375]").show(); //shoe
  84.  
  85. $("div[class*=field_140]").show(); //eye color male/female
  86. $("div[class*=field_147]").show(); //hair length
  87.  
  88. $("div[class*=field_419]").hide(); //hair length
  89.  
  90. $("div[class*=field_208]").show(); //hair color male/female
  91. $("div[class*=field_209]").show(); //skin color male/female
  92. $("div[class*=field_216]").show(); //tatoos male/female
  93. $("div[class*=field_219]").show(); //piercings male/female
  94. $("div[class*=field_222]").show(); //etnicity male/female
  95. $("div[class*=field_229]").show(); //Generes
  96. $("div[class*=field_452]").show(); //haircol
  97. $("div[class*=field_797").show(); //agencies
  98. $("div[class*=field_229").show(); //generes
  99.  
  100.  
  101. } else if ( selected.indexOf('Male Model') != -1 ) {
  102. $("div[class*=field_96]").show(); //height male and female
  103. $("div[class*=field_91]").show(); //weight male and female
  104. $("div[class*=field_370]").show(); //neck only men
  105. $("div[class*=field_371]").show(); //sleeve male model
  106. $("div[class*=field_1216]").show(); //date of birth
  107. $("div[class*=field_131]").show(); //shoe male and female
  108. $("div[class*=field_375]").show(); //shoe
  109.  
  110. $("div[class*=field_373]").show(); //chest only men
  111. $("div[class*=field_99]").show(); //hips only men
  112. $("div[class*=field_374]").show(); //inseam only men
  113. $("div[class*=field_112]").show(); //dress only woman
  114. $("div[class*=field_140]").show(); //eye color male/female
  115. $("div[class*=field_147]").show(); //hair length male/female
  116. $("div[class*=field_208]").show(); //hair color male/female
  117. $("div[class*=field_209]").show(); //skin color male/female
  118. $("div[class*=field_216]").show(); //tatoos male/female
  119. $("div[class*=field_219]").show(); //piercings male/female
  120. $("div[class*=field_222]").show(); //etnicity male/female
  121. $("div[class*=field_229]").show(); //Generes
  122. $("div[class*=field_452]").show(); //hair col
  123. $("div[class*=field_797").show(); //agencies
  124. $("div[class*=field_229").show(); //generes
  125. } else {
  126. $("div[class*=field_96]").hide();
  127. $("div[class*=field_131]").hide(); //shoe male and female
  128. $("div[class*=field_91]").hide();
  129. $("div[class*=field_97]").hide();
  130. $("div[class*=field_98]").hide();
  131. $("div[class*=field_1216]").hide();
  132. $("div[class*=field_99]").hide();
  133. $("div[class*=field_100]").hide();
  134. $("div[class*=field_112]").hide();
  135. $("div[class*=field_140]").hide();
  136. $("div[class*=field_147]").hide();
  137. $("div[class*=field_208]").hide();
  138. $("div[class*=field_209]").hide();
  139. $("div[class*=field_216]").hide();
  140. $("div[class*=field_219]").hide();
  141. $("div[class*=field_222]").hide();
  142. $("div[class*=field_370]").hide();
  143. $("div[class*=field_371]").hide();
  144. $("div[class*=field_372]").hide();
  145. $("div[class*=field_374]").hide();
  146. $("div[class*=field_375]").hide();
  147. $("div[class*=field_393]").hide();
  148. $("div[class*=field_419]").hide();
  149. $("div[class*=field_453]").hide();
  150. $("div[class*=field_456]").hide();
  151. $("div[class*=field_452]").hide();
  152. $("div[class*=field_797").hide(); //agencies
  153. $("div[class*=field_229").hide(); //generes
  154.  
  155. }
  156. });
  157. });
  158. </script>
  159.  
  160. <?php
  161.  
  162. }
  163. }
  164.  
  165. add_action('wp_footer', 'sqr_dev_load_conditional_jquery');
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ement